SEZL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
88 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sezzle (SEZL)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$166M — up 140% from $68.9M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 46 funds opened new SEZL posit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 45 holders — while 19 added to existing stakes and 18 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Driehaus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$8.13M. The largest seller was G2 Investment Partners Management, cutting an estimated $7.98M.
